Arise Sir Nigel

Speciality beer importers James Clay are celebrating the second member of their team to be awarded the title of Honorary Knight.

Nigel Stevenson, of Leeds-based Speciality beer importers James Clay, has been made “Honorary Knight of Brewers’ Mashstaff” by the Guild of Belgian Brewers in the Grand Place Brussels.

For centuries, the Knighthood or ‘Chevalerie du Fourquet des Brasseurs’ has been bestowed upon individuals, who are deemed to have rendered great service to the Belgian brewing profession.

“To be invited to join the ranks of the Knights is quite an honour,” added Sir Nigel, graciously.

“The ceremony included a good helping of pageantry with elegantly-robed dignitaries and fanfares of trumpets. It was like being back at Elland Road on a local derby day, an unforgettable experience for a poor northern lad.”
